1421

. . . . 27. (fn. 1)
Before Meaux.
Thomas Sawyer 'maleman' of the king's wardrobe is sent to the abbot and convent of Eynesham, to take such maintenance as Roger Semper deceased had therein. By p.s. [1151.]
